Description-en: PWM enrichment analysis
A toolkit of high-level functions for DNA motif scanning
and enrichment analysis built upon Biostrings. The main
functionality is PWM enrichment analysis of already known PWMs
(e.g. from databases such as MotifDb), but the package also
implements high-level functions for PWM scanning and
visualisation. The package does not perform "de novo" motif
discovery, but is instead focused on using motifs that are
either experimentally derived or computationally constructed by
other tools.
